Recording artist Ty Blacke is currently working on his debut worship album, titled “Redemption & Faith.” This project is distinct from his previously released singles, “Commit To You” and “The Righteous Judge” (feat. Aidan Frost), in both its genre focus and its structural approach.

“Redemption & Faith” is conceived as a chronological redemption story. This means that the songs on the album are arranged to unfold a narrative, guiding the listener through a specific journey. Each track contributes to this overarching theme, building upon the previous one to tell a complete story of redemption.

What does “chronological redemption story” mean for the listener?

When an album is described as a “chronological redemption story,” it implies a few things for the listening experience:

  • Narrative Flow: The tracks are intended to be heard in order. The album is not a collection of standalone songs, but rather a cohesive work where each song plays a part in a larger story.
  • Thematic Development: The lyrical content and musical arrangements are crafted to reflect different stages of a redemption journey. This could involve themes of struggle, realization, hope, forgiveness, and restoration.
  • Immersive Experience: The goal is often to create an immersive experience where the listener can follow the narrative arc from beginning to end.

This approach to album creation is common in concept albums, where a central theme or story ties all the songs together. For “Redemption & Faith,” that central theme is redemption, presented chronologically.

How does it compare to his released singles?

Ty Blacke has released two singles to date: “Commit To You” and “The Righteous Judge” (feat. Aidan Frost). While these tracks showcase his musical style, “Redemption & Faith” is a different kind of project.

  • Genre Focus: “Redemption & Faith” is explicitly a worship album. While the singles may have worshipful elements, the album is fully dedicated to this genre.
  • Album Structure: The singles are individual releases. “Redemption & Faith” is an album designed with an intentional narrative sequence.

There is currently no release date set for “Redemption & Faith.” Updates on the album’s progress and release will be shared on this site and through the music mailing list.
